Junior Civic League celebrates Founder’s Day
The Junior Civic League recently hosted its Founder’s Day celebration to commemorate the vision of its first members. Special guests included founder members Geneva Mason and Juanita Williams. Mason was the first president of the JCL, and Williams served as president while an active member. Sustaining members also in attendance included Doris Bullock, Edrice Clark, Anne Cobbin, Betty Scott, Molly Seals and Elsina Winston. Seals, past president and sustaining member, was the speaker. She emphasized the fiduciary duties and responsibilites of each member and the importance of continuing the group’s traditions. The purpose of the JCL is to create an interest in the health, educational and civic affairs of the community in order to promote better understanding, with volunteerism being one of the major objectives.
